Cameroon - Value Added of Agriculture, Forestry and Fishing
Since 2014, Cameroon Value Added of Agriculture, Forestry and Fishing grew 2.5% year on year. With $5,620.63 Million in 2019, the country was number 61 among other countries in Value Added of Agriculture, Forestry and Fishing. Cameroon is overtaken by Hungary, which was number 60 at $5,622.88 Million and is followed by Cambodia at $5,549.44 Million. India topped the ranking with $422,968.92 Million in 2019, that is a growth of 4.2% compared to 2018. United States, Indonesia and Nigeria resp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Kenya recorded the best 5 years average growth at +12.9% per year, while South Sudan witnessed the worst performance at -29.2% per year.
